In a first, the West Bengal government has made it mandatory for cinema halls and multiplexes to screen Bengali films for a minimum of 120 days in a year during prime time. Prime-time shows are those scheduled between 12 noon to 9 pm.

While necessary amendments to the West Bengal Cinema (Regulation of Public Exhibitions) Rules, 1956 will be made in due course, the new order will be applicable on an immediate basis and is aimed at encouraging the Bengali film industry.

Why is this important? Before 2016, all was not well with the Bengali film industry as it was grappling with losses.

For three consecutive years — 2013, 2014, 2015 — the Bengali film industry did not see financial gains. In 2013 and 2014, the industry incurred losses to the tune of Rs 70 crore but the losses increased to Rs 100 crore in 2015.
